An image-forming apparatus for forming an image by electrically charging a photosensitive material, forming an electrostatic image through the exposure to light and developing the electrostatic image, wherein the main charged potential (Vo) of the photosensitive material, the potential (Vr) of the exposed portion of the photosensitive material and the developing bias potential DB are so set as to satisfy the following formulas (1) and (2),<paragraph lvl="0"><in-line-formula>V1<=|DB-Vr|<=V2 (1)</in-line-formula><paragraph lvl="0"><in-line-formula>V3<=|Vo-DB|<=300 (2)</in-line-formula>wherein V1, V2 and V3 are parameters calculated from a developing characteristics curve obtained by plotting the image densities to a potential difference between he developing bias potential and the surface potential (0 V) of the photosensitive material of when the image is formed by changing the developing bias potential with the exposure amount being zero in a state where the potential on the surface of the photosensitive material is maintained at zero, V1 being a potential difference (absolute value) at a point at where an approximated straight line A in a region where the image density linearly increases intersects an approximated straight line B in a region where the image density increases to its saturation on the developing characteristics curve; V2 being a potential difference (absolute value) at a point at where the approximated straight line B separates away from the developing characteristics curve; and V3 being a potential difference (absolute value) at a point at where the image density exhibits a value of (base paper density +0.005).
